Give 3 differences betn. Multiple fission and spore formation

Multiple fission occurs in unicellular organisms whereas spore formation occurs in simple multi-cellular organisms.
Example of organism showing multiple fission is Plasmodium whereas Rhizopus shows spore formation.
In multiple fission, the nucleus of the parent cell undergoes repeated divisions to produce many daughter nuclei. The cytoplasm also divides and cleaves around each nucleus forming several daughter cells in the parent cell.
Organisms like Rhizopus produces spores in reproductive structures called sporangia. Each spore has a thick wall to protect it. The spore germinates to produce a new organism.
